Eberechi Eze opts for Dennis Bergkamp’s shirt number at Arsenal

Arsenal newest signing Eberechi Eze has opted to pick the number 10 shirt worn by some of the biggest names in our history, such as Dennis Bergkamp at Emirates Stadium.
Recall that the Gunners signed Eze from Crystal Palace after hijacking him from their neighbours, Tottenham Hotspur, who had also made moves to sign him.
The former Crystal Palace star was unveiled as Arsenal’s new player on Saturday after their 5-0 win against Leeds United in the Premier League.
Eze donned the number 10 shirt when he played for Palace, and also wants to retain the digit at Emirates Stadium.
“I know what it means,” Ebere stated speaking about the history behind number 10 shirt at Arsenal.
“It’s a privilege and an honour, because I know the names that have worn this shirt before me. I see this opportunity as something that’s like a blessing, so just to be able to be here, I’m going to give everything I have to pay back this type of respect.”
Meanwhile, Eze is expected to make his debut for Arsenal when they play against Premier League champions Liverpool at Anfield on Sunday.
Eze has been tipped to start at the front alongside Noni Madueke and Viktor Gyokeres.
